CNG is now cheaper in Gurgaon

CNG prices have dropped in the Gurgaon city after CNG filling stations in Sectors 53 and 29 started receiving direct CNG supply through a pipeline.

This should reduce the load on these pumps resulting in smaller queues.

Haryana Gas Distribution Company Limited has announced that the prices are now down by Rs. 3.50.

M S Khatkar, senior vice-president, HGDCL added in a statement: “Now, CNG is available at Rs 24/kg in the city. It was Rs 27.50/kg earlier. In the past five days since two filling stations started getting supply through pipeline, CNG sales have doubled from 3,000kg to 6,000kg.”

CNG has become a very popular alternative fuel for car owners as it turns out to be pretty cost effective. The running cost of a petrol engine car drops drastically if CNG is used on it.
